UN Security Council Reform: India Prioritizes Permanent Membership

February 21, New Delhi – India's Deputy Permanent Representative to the UN, Yojna Patel, delivered a statement at the Intergovernmental Negotiations on UN Security Council reforms, focusing on membership categories.

Ambassador Yojna Patel stated that the Council has failed to fulfill its core responsibilities regarding peace and security. She emphasized that reforms must include the expansion of permanent membership, arguing that without this, the process would be incomplete. Patel rejected proposals introducing a third category, stating that they risk delaying real reform for decades. She also insisted that any restructuring must correct, not exacerbate, existing imbalances.
